Peche Mortel

Color is dark brown, nearly black with a finger of brown, frothy head. Strong aroma of coffee, chocolate, and dark malts. Taste is superb, with dark, bitter coffee flavors, along with dark chocolate and molasses. Roasted malts are robust and intense. But it's not sweet at all, which we like. However, there is a smoky, charred flavor that takes over after the first couple sips, which would make for a great campfire beer. Mouthfeel is smooth and warming, with the 9.5% pretty tamed. Finishes with even more flavors of black coffee and dark chocolate. Incredible taste and smoothness with this Imperial Stout!
